What is a good size for a 1 bed flat?

Generally speaking, a 1-bedroom apartment should be at least 450 square feet. Anything less than that is usually considered a studio apartment. By way of example, a 2 car garage in a house is about 400 square feet so having something a little larger than that makes sense.

What is a house with one bedroom called?

A studio apartment, by definition, is a single-room dwelling that combines the bedroom, kitchen, and living area into one large room. The open floor plan does not have walls separating the sleeping and living areas, and the kitchen area may or may not be separated by a wall.

Can you live in a one bedroom flat with a child UK?

No, not by the law you won’t be. A one bedroom property is considered suitable housing for one adult and one child in social housing terms – and you won’t be overcrowded until your kid is at least 10 because before then she only counts as half a person, and a one bed is for two people.

What is the average size of a one bed flat UK?

495 sq ft

The average UK one-bedroom home is 46 sq m (495 sq ft), according to Riba. That works out at a mere 6.8m x 6.8m or 22ft by 22ft. And that’s the mean average. There are plenty of people living in smaller flats.

What age does a child need their own room legally UK?

If you’re in council housing or your house is owned by a Housing Association, you’re entitled to a bedroom for every person over 16 years old (18 years old in Northern Ireland) and every married couple so you shouldn’t need to share a room with your child. Can a boy and girl share a room Legally UK?

Currently in the UK there is no law in place defining the age that siblings should stop sharing a bedroom, even if they are the opposite sex.

Is there a minimum size for a flat in UK?

Under the national space standard, the minimum floor area for any new home is 37m² – almost three times the size – yet these ‘homes’ are allowed to be built because the rules do not allow them to be rejected on space grounds.

Which wall should be your feature wall?

The feature wall should be used to highlight the room’s existing focal point. For instance, the wall where the mantel sits, or even where the TV is, makes for a good feature wall. The wall behind the headboard in a bedroom is also ideal.

    What is a studio flat UK?

    In the United Kingdom (British), a studio flat is usually a single room with cooking facilities which has its own bathroom attached. Traditionally, if a dwelling has a shared bathroom, it is known as a bedsit.
